Aktiviere Job-Benachrichtigungen per E-Mail!

Senior Software Engineer C++ (all genders)

TeamViewer

Karlsruhe

Vor Ort

EUR 65.000 - 85.000

Vollzeit

Vor 23 Tagen

Zusammenfassung

A leading software company in Karlsruhe is seeking a (Senior) Software Engineer C++ to develop innovative solutions for their remote access platform. The ideal candidate should have a strong background in C++, experience in software architecture, and a passion for learning new technologies. This role offers outstanding compensation, hybrid work options, and a vibrant company culture with a focus on diversity.

Leistungen

Great compensation and benefits packages
Company achievement bonus and stocks
Premiums for the private pension plan
Public transport friendly offices
Option to lease an e-bike
Special terms for local gyms
Work From Abroad Program up to 40 days

Qualifikationen

  • Several years of professional experience in object-oriented software development using C++.
  • Enthusiasm for learning and adapting to new technologies.

Aufgaben

  • Define the architecture and develop functionalities using modern C++.
  • Optimize software with efficient algorithms and technologies.
  • Ensure code quality and compliance with specifications.
  • Advise on feasibility studies and time estimates for new functionalities.

Kenntnisse

Object-oriented software development
C++
Team player
Analytical thinking
C#
Fluency in English
German proficiency

Ausbildung

University or college degree in Computer Science or related field
Jobbeschreibung
Responsibilities

We are looking for a (Senior) Software Engineer C++ (all genders) to actively contribute to the development for our remote access solution and server-side applications. The position provides an excellent opportunity to create impact and add value in an agile, modern environment.

  • Define the architecture, design and develop functionalities for our client and services using modern C++
  • Optimize and enhance our software with new, efficient algorithms and technologies
  • Work independently on solutions for specified requirements and be responsible for complying with time and quality specifications
  • Be responsible for ensuring efficient implementation and for code of the highest quality
  • Recommend and implement improvements to architecture / technologies to further enhance our systems and codebase regarding reliability, maintainability, scalability, and performance
  • Monitor the latest technical developments in your field and initiate improvements
  • Act as an advisor towards product owners (feasibility studies and time estimates for new functionality to be implemented)
Requirements
  • University or college degree in Computer Science, Business Informatics, Software Engineering, or any related subject
  • Several years of professional experience in the field of object-oriented software development using C++ and design patterns
  • Enthusiasm for other technologies such as C#
  • Experience in any of the following fields would be desirable : parallel programming, distributed and scalable systems, security, SQL, CQL, or network communication
  • Structured and analytical way of thinking / working, being a team player, as well as motivated to learn new things
  • Fluency in English is mandatory, German is a plus
What we offer
  • Onsite Onboarding in our HQ office for an optimal start
  • Great compensation and benefits packages including company achievement bonus and company stocks, regular salary reviews
  • Premiums for the private pension plan (BAV) up to the maximum amount are topped up by TeamViewer
  • Public transport friendly offices
  • Option to lease an e-bike
  • Special terms for local gyms
  • Access toCorporateBenefitsplatformwith many discounts
  • Regular Team events and company-wide celebrations
  • Open door policy , no dress code rules, frequent all Hands and Leadership Lunches
  • Hybrid and Flexible work time with up to 60% home office
  • Work From Abroad Program allowing up to 40 days of work outside your contracting country
  • We celebrate diversity as one of core values, join and drive one of the c-a-r-e initiatives together with us!
Hol dir deinen kostenlosen, vertraulichen Lebenslauf-Check.
eine PDF-, DOC-, DOCX-, ODT- oder PAGES-Datei bis zu 5 MB per Drag & Drop ablegen.